Transaction 9604341e071a842c2098a314853c93f8aea8e86c278b5d118be9af4a00fbf75e

2 Input
1 Outputs
  • 9604341e071a842c2098a314853c93f8aea8e86c278b5d118be9af4a00fbf75e:0
  • value  7885
    address  39gBYSRWec31eadRgyZSrchvHs53CqmBsk